Nightly Reindex — Lumenquill Search

The reindex job for Lumenquill kicks off at 02:10 local time and drains the staging queue before touching the primary shards. Verify that the Harrowfield replica is caught up, then confirm the snapshot from the previous run was archived. If both checks pass, trigger the orchestrator manually. The orchestrator authenticates against the internal index service using the key below.

service key, bajog-yahop: kto7_mMHVCpJ

Subject: Payslips for the Brackwell yard

Hi dispatch team,

As you know, the Brackwell yard still doesn't have a working printer (the replacement is stuck in procurement, don't ask), so we're printing this month's payslips here at Tindermoor House and sending them over by courier again. They'll be sealed and bundled by shift, ready for collection Thursday morning. Please book the usual secure run and flag it as confidential documents. One more thing — the hand-over instruction for the courier is below.

handover note for yagef-bagep: the drudor pelius courier leaves the kasdor zorvan norir ledger at gate 8016 under passcode 755406

Welcome to the Scanline rotation! Our barcode scanner integration (the Wandleport bridge) syncs SKU reads into the Crateloom inventory service every thirty seconds. If reads stall, restart the bridge pod first — nine times out of ten that fixes it. Redeploys must be signed before the Wandleport fleet will accept them. Use the key below when pushing a hotfix.

rollout seal: bky4_DFM9

Handover Note — Director Transition

For the board: I am passing the second-source supplier search for the Kelverin valve line to Director Masha Orlenko. Three candidates in the Torvald region have passed initial vetting; one site audit remains. Pricing parity looks achievable by Q3. Masha will present the shortlist at the next board session. Context on wider intent follows below.

confidential, yajof-fadug: Project Julvan slips by one quarter because of the audit delay.

Hey — the Driftbin retention sweeper on the Oakmarsh cluster is misconfigured again. Someone copied the staging env into prod, so the sweeper thinks retention is 7 days instead of 90 and it's been happily deleting recent audit rows. Restore from last night's snapshot is underway. For the next release, please ship the corrected env file as-is. The sweeper authenticates to the archive store before each run, and the very next line sets that credential.

secret setting of yafof-tawep: RELAY_SECRET8=8abb5772